Detailed Description
The LR7-72HVD-625M is the entry-level model in the Hi-MO X10 Explorer series, offering a maximum power output of 625W and a module efficiency of 23.1%. Designed for industrial and commercial rooftops, this module is particularly suited for high-temperature environments, such as cement roofs in manufacturing plants or warehouses.
Key Features:
- BC-Cell Technology: The use of BC-Cell technology ensures lower operating temperatures, which is critical for maintaining performance in hot climates. By eliminating front-side metal contacts, the module reduces shading and resistive losses, resulting in higher energy yield.
- Dual-Glass Design: The module features 2.0+2.0mm semi-tempered glass, providing robust protection against environmental factors such as hail, dust, and moisture. This design also enhances the module’s fire resistance, meeting UL Type 29 and IEC Class C standards.
- Low Degradation: The module has a first-year degradation of less than 1% and an annual degradation of only 0.35% from year 2 to year 30. This ensures a 92.5% power retention after 30 years, making it a reliable long-term investment.
- Customizable Output Cable: The output cable length can be customized from -200mm to +1400mm, providing flexibility in installation and system design.

Certifications and Warranty:
The module is certified under IEC 61215, IEC 61730, UL 61730, ISO9001:2015, ISO14001:2015, ISO45001:2018, and IEC62941, ensuring compliance with international quality and safety standards. It comes with a 15-year warranty for materials and processing and a 30-year warranty for extra linear power output, providing peace of mind for long-term investments.
Performance in Extreme Conditions:
The 625M is designed to operate in temperatures ranging from -40°C to +85°C, making it suitable for both cold and hot climates. Its temperature coefficient of -0.260%/°C for Pmax ensures minimal power loss even in high-temperature environments.
Mechanical Durability:
The module can withstand a front-side static load of 5400Pa and a rear-side static load of 2400Pa, making it resilient against heavy snow or wind loads. It has also passed the hailstone test, withstanding 25mm hailstones at a speed of 23m/s.
